Because so many Licensed Vocational Nurses eventually want to become Registered Nurses, LVN to RN programs in California are extremely popular. Usually referred to as bridge programs, these courses are designed to help LVNs pass the NCLEX-RN examination that is required in order to become a Registered Nurse. Coursework focuses on the theories and clinical aspects of RN work, and can be taken through any approved online or on-campus program. Many vocational nurses immediately begin an RN bridge program soon after finishing whichever of the LVN programs they’ve recently completed.
Why Become an RN?
Registered Nurses not only earn a lot more than LVNs, but they also have more employment opportunities and options for career advancement. Pay for Registered Nurses in nearly 60% higher than the average LVN salary. RNs also enjoy greater flexibility in both their job environment and work schedules than do LVNs. With additional schooling, they even have the opportunity to advance into BSN (Bachelor of Science in Nursing), MSN (Master of Science in Nursing) and PhD-level positions in the medical field.
What are the Requirements for LVN to RN Programs in California?
In order to be admitted to an LVN to RN bridge program, applicants are required to already be a Licensed Vocational Nurse, to have a high school diploma or GED, and to have recorded a 2.0 GPA or better on all of their post-secondary coursework (i.e. any courses taken at one of the accredited LVN programs in California). Some programs also require students to have completed certain classes (e.g. anatomy, physiology, etc.) in the last five years, or get a “recency waiver” excluding them from this requirement based on their relevant work experience.
